SABE Posted September 23, 2010 Share Posted September 23, 2010 There's no workbook that goes with the older FLL 1/2. The lessons are done orally. Levels 3 and 4 each have a workbook. Quote Link to comment Share on other sites More sharing options...
monalisa Posted September 23, 2010 Share Posted September 23, 2010 FWIW, there are no workbooks for the new FLL 1 and FLL2 either. They are now paperback large format (similar to OPGTR) but not workbooks -- you still do all the work orally or on a separate sheet of paper (for copywork etc.).
